The contract requires coordination of regulatory compliance documentation such as labels, safety data sheets, and packaging specifications to ensure full adherence to DLA and federal requirements before any shipment occurs. This work is critical to maintaining compliance with military and defense procurement standards, specifically tied to the Department of Defense’s Medical Supply Chain FSH. The performance location is Joint Base Charleston, with a strict deadline for responses by August 10, 2026, and the contract is classified as a subcontract under the NAICS code 561990 for other support services. All documentation must be accurate, complete, and submitted in a timely manner to avoid delays in logistics and deployment readiness.
